Current DC?

Don't read Final Crisis.  Not because it's a bad book but because it'll be confusing if you don't know the characters and there are a LOT of characters.  Also don't read anything that says "McKeever" or "Winnick" on the cover.  GL Corps and Secret Six have been pretty dang good lately, but honestly, I'd start out with a trade if I were you.

Identity Crisis and Kingdom Come are probably the best two jump on points for the entire DCU.  If you know more about which character you are interested in, I can recommend some others: Flash: Rogues, Flash: Secret of Barry Allen (followed by Rogue War), Green Arrow: Quiver (followed by Sound of Violence and Archer's Quest), 52 vol 1-4, Batman: No Man's Land, Batman: Knightfall, Batman: Hush, Teen Titans: Judas Contract, and Villains United are all relatively easy to find trades that are good reads for their respective characters or teams.

Justice League trades by Morrison and Justice Society (JSA) trades by Johns are also recommended.
